Intraday Price Action and Outperformance Context
Cyient DLM Ltd touched an intraday high of Rs 697.85, marking a 12.05% rise from the previous close. The stock’s intraday volatility was notably elevated at 30.43%, reflecting heightened trading activity and investor interest. This performance contrasts sharply with the Sensex’s 0.61% decline, underscoring the stock’s resilience and sector-leading momentum on the day. The 11.79% gain also extends a three-day winning streak, during which the stock has rallied 19.66%, signalling sustained buying pressure rather than a one-off spike. Recent Performance Trajectory
Looking back over the past month, Cyient DLM Ltd has delivered an impressive 44.91% gain, far outpacing the Sensex’s marginal 0.14% decline. Over three months, the stock’s return balloons to 86.72%, while its year-to-date performance stands at a robust 68.30%, compared with the Sensex’s 9.67% loss. This trajectory highlights a strong recovery and sustained momentum, with the recent surge reinforcing an already bullish trend. The stock’s ability to maintain gains over multiple timeframes suggests underlying strength rather than a short-lived bounce. Moving Average Configuration
The technical setup for Cyient DLM Ltd is notably robust. The stock is trading above all its key moving averages — the 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day — a configuration that typically signals strength and confirms the uptrend. The 50-day moving average, often regarded as a critical resistance or support level, has been decisively surpassed, removing a significant technical barrier. This alignment of short-, medium-, and long-term averages supports the view that today’s surge is a continuation of existing momentum rather than a mere recovery bounce. Technical Indicators
The daily moving averages signal a bullish trend, consistent with the price action and moving average alignment. However, the weekly and monthly technical indicators present a more nuanced picture. The weekly MACD is bullish, supporting short-term momentum, but the monthly MACD is mildly bearish, suggesting some caution over the longer term. The weekly RSI is bearish, indicating the stock may be overbought in the near term, while the monthly RSI also remains bearish. Bollinger Bands readings are bullish on both weekly and monthly charts, implying volatility is expanding in favour of the upside. The KST indicator is bearish on the weekly timeframe but lacks a monthly signal. Dow Theory readings are mildly bullish on both weekly and monthly scales, and the On-Balance Volume (OBV) shows no clear trend weekly but mild bullishness monthly. This mixed technical landscape suggests the surge is supported by short-term momentum but tempered by longer-term caution. Market Context
While Cyient DLM Ltd surged, the broader market was under pressure. The Sensex opened 85.16 points lower and closed down 389.18 points at 76,995.77, a 0.61% decline. The Sensex remains above its 50-day moving average, but the 50 DMA itself is below the 200 DMA, indicating a mixed medium-term market trend. The Industrial Manufacturing sector, where Cyient DLM Ltd operates, lagged behind the stock’s performance, making the 11.47 percentage point outperformance even more noteworthy. This divergence highlights the stock’s idiosyncratic strength amid a cautious market environment.
